Johnnie Beatrice Nall

February 19, 1920 — October 9, 2018

Funeral services for Johnnie Beatrice Nall, 98, are set for 11:00 AM Saturday, October 13, 2018 at the Lewisville Church of Christ with Jeff Jenkins officiating. Burial will follow in the Era Cemetery at 2:00 PM. A viewing will take place one hour before the service.
Johnnie was born on February 19, 1920 in Era to John Robert Little and Elsie Iris (Bentley) Little. She passed away on October 9, 2018 in Flower Mound.
Johnnie married J.C. Nall on October 11, 1941. She was a longtime member of the Lewisville Church of Christ. She was a retired school teacher, and continued tutoring children long after her retirement. Johnnie loved to travel, and visited many countries around the world.
She is survived by her daughter Glenda Nall and her husband Chuck of Gainesville; son DeWayne Nall and his wife Linda of Fort Worth; granddaughter Maechele Nall; and several nieces and nephews. She is also survived by her loving church family.
She was preceded in death by her parents; husband J.C. Nall; son Keith Nall; sister Earline Sheilds; and sister Quade Flowers.
